    Entrez Gene SummaryThis gene catalyzes a two-step reaction that involves the transfer of the adenosyl moiety of ATP to methionine to form S-adenosylmethionine and tripolyphosphate, which is subsequently cleaved to PPi and Pi. S-adenosylmethionine is the source of methyl groups for most biological methylations. The encoded protein is found as a homotetramer (MAT I) or a homodimer (MAT III) whereas a third form, MAT II (gamma), is encoded by the MAT2A gene. Mutations in this gene are associated with methionine adenosyltransferase deficiency.

    UniProt SummaryFUNCTION: SwissProt: Q00266 # Catalyzes the formation of S-adenosylmethionine from methionine and ATP.
    COFACTOR: Binds 2 divalent ions per subunit. Magnesium or cobalt (By similarity). & Binds 1 potassium ion per subunit (By similarity).
    SIZE: 395 amino acids; 43648 Da
    SUBUNIT: Homotetramer (MAT-I) or homodimer (MAT-III).
    TISSUE SPECIFICITY: Expressed in liver.
    DISEASE: SwissProt: Q00266 # Defects in MAT1A are a cause of a form of hypermethioninemia [MIM:250850]; also called MAT I/III deficiency. The disease is characterized by fetid breath and dimethylsulfide excretion. Most mutations are transmitted in an autosomal recessive manner, but autosomal dominant inheritance has also been observed. The clinical consequences of hypermethioninemia are poorly understood. In some individuals, hypermethioninemia is apparently benign; in others, association of neurological problems with null mutations has been observed.
    SIMILARITY: SwissProt: Q00266 ## Belongs to the AdoMet synthetase family.
